Three men and a woman from B-C face a long list of human trafficking related charges thanks to an alert off-duty RCMP officer.
He spotted three vehicles traveling close to each other at a high rate of speed Wednesday on Highway 1 near Swift Current.
Police pulled them over for exceeding 150 km an hour.
They became suspicious after finding two young girls who didn’t have identification in the back seat of two of the vehicles shielded by tinted windows.
The four accused who range in age from 19 to 36 appear Friday morning in Swift Current Provincial Court.
The two young girls are also from B-C and not related to the adults facing charges.
